Hello, One possible solution: procedure TMainForm.UniFormCreate(Sender: TObject); begin with UniContainerPanel1.JSInterface do begin JSConfig('border', [1]); JSAddListener('afterrender', 'function(){this.setStyle("border-color", "green"); this.setStyle("border-style", "solid")}'); end; end;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
